Andy Lopata welcomes Levent Yildizgoren, author of Good Business in Any Language and host of the Thriving in Global Markets podcast. He has helped companies do business in more than 100 languages! Andy and Levent dive into the importance of cultural intelligence in leadership, particularly for leaders of multinational teams, and discuss how understanding cultural differences can improve business outcomes.
Levent Yildizgoren starts by introducing the concept of cultural intelligence (CQ). He explains that CQ is the ability to effectively navigate and engage with different cultures. Drawing insights from his personal and professional experiences, he highlights the significance of cultural intelligence in everyday interactions. Empathy emerges as a key component of developing cultural intelligence. Levent emphasises the need to recognise the importance of empathy while emphasising that cultural intelligence is a skill that must be cultivated. Leaders must actively learn and adapt as they navigate professional spaces shared with individuals from diverse cultural backgrounds.
One critical aspect impacted by cultural differences is communication. Levent stresses the need for leaders to be aware of the nuances in communication styles across cultures to avoid misinterpretations. It is vital to avoid making hasty assumptions or jumping to conclusions without considering the cultural context. Respect for differences is another vital aspect discussed by Andy and Levent. It is so important to understand and respect the diverse cultures encountered in the professional world. Leaders should approach cultural interactions with humility and avoid assuming that their own culture is superior.
Highlighting the consequences of cultural misunderstandings, Levent cites the example of Dolce & Gabbana's advertising campaign, which went terribly wrong due to a lack of cultural understanding. This misstep resulted in a significant negative backlash and Levent stresses that it is necessary to respect and understand the differences that make our world fascinating. Embracing this diversity fosters harmonious and inclusive professional environments, allowing individuals to thrive in a multicultural setting.
The key takeaways from this episode are: removing assumptions and acknowledging cultural differences; cultivating empathy and humility in cultural interactions; recognising and adapting to diverse communication styles; respecting and understanding cultural differences for inclusivity; and continually learning and developing cultural intelligence.
